site stats

Radix-4 fft matlab

WebFigure 3.4: A Simple Radix 4 DIF FFT algorithm. When N is a power of 4, i.e. N =4p, a radix-4 FFT can be used instead of a radix-2 FFT. With a radix-4 the computational complexity is … WebFast Fourier Transform Algorithm radix 4 64 point. Contribute to dmncmn/FFT_radix4 development by creating an account on GitHub.

FPGA implementation of 16-point radix-4 complex FFT core using …

Web4 N. In comparisonof radix-2 FFT, number of complex multiplications are reduce by 25% but number of complex additions are increased by 50%. Fig 2 shows a signal flow graph of Radix-4 butterfly decimation-in- frequency algorithm and signal flow graph for 64-point DIF FFT. Fig 1 (a) and Fig (b) signal flow graph of radix-4 butterfly DIF FFT ... office manager opis posla https://pamusicshop.com

Implementation of High Throughput Radix-16 FFT Algorithm

Web(2)Audio Codecs : AACLC Encoder – I have implemented Radix-2, Radix-4, Split Radix FFT algorithms using C, both recursive and non-recursive versions, that are highly time and memory efficient Algorithm Implementations, that resulted in savings of more than 80% in terms of MIPS count on ARM9E. WebApr 5, 2024 · 在本次开发中,我们选择了FFT点数为1024,8位的输入和输出端口宽度,并选择了基于radix-2算法的离散傅里叶变换(DFT)。本次开发使用Xilinx公司的vivado设计 … WebJul 15, 2013 · a simple way of looking at a radix-4 FFT is to think of one radix-4 butterfly as containing 4 radix-2 butterflies; 2 butterflies in one pass and 2 butterflies in the following pass. and the twiddle factors are the same except the complex twiddle factor for the the butterflies are off by a phase difference of π 2. but all that means is swapping … office manager palkka

Design and Implementation of 256‐Point Radix‐4 100 …

Category:29209 - LogiCORE Fast Fourier Transform (FFT) - Release Notes …

Tags:Radix-4 fft matlab

Radix-4 fft matlab

FPGA implementation of 16-point radix-4 complex FFT core using …

WebNov 6, 2024 · More specifically: radix4FFT3_FixPtEML.m is a Simulink model of the radix-4 FFT. It has been optimized, and it can even be used for code generation. You can invoke it from any Simulink model to perform its services. There are basically four reasons to do this kind of work in Simulink: WebSep 1, 2016 · radix4FFT3_FixPtEML.m is an Embedded MATLAB version of the radix-4 FFT that can be used in Simulink. You can also generate C code for this code (using Real Time …

Radix-4 fft matlab

Did you know?

WebThe butterfly of a radix-4 algorithm consists of four inputs and four outputs (see Figure 1). The FFT length is 4M, where M is the number of stages. A stage is half of radix-2. The … WebRadix -16 FFT is obtained by cascaded the radix -4 butterfly units. It facilitates low-complexity realization of radix-16 butterfly operation and high operation speed due to its optimized pipelined structure. The proposed radix-16 FFT algorithm is area-efficient with high data processing rate and hardware utilization efficiency.

WebApr 5, 2024 · 在本次开发中,我们选择了FFT点数为1024,8位的输入和输出端口宽度,并选择了基于radix-2算法的离散傅里叶变换(DFT)。本次开发使用Xilinx公司的vivado设计开发套件,其中包含了FFT IP核,大大简化了FFT变换算法的设计过程。通过本次开发,我们掌握了基于vivado核的FFT傅里叶变换开发方法,并了解了 ... WebMay 7, 2011 · universal mixed radix fast fourier transform FFT iFFT c++ source code radix-2 radix-3 radix-4 radix-5 radix-7 radix-11 c++ , + inverse table, with shift fi . Quicker version of iFFT is 2 times quicker that previous version because it calculates FFT witch tables instead of complex number objects - GitHub - rewertynpl/mixed-radix-FFT: universal mixed radix …

WebMar 15, 2013 · For anyone searching an educating matlab implementation, here is what I scribbled together just now: Theme Copy function X = myFFT (x) %only works if N = 2^k N = numel (x); xp = x (1:2:end); xpp = x (2:2:end); if N>=8 Xp = myFFT (xp); Xpp = myFFT (xpp); X = zeros (N,1); Wn = exp (-1i*2*pi* ( (0:N/2-1)')/N); tmp = Wn .* Xpp; WebRADIX-2 FFT The radix-2 FFT algorithms are used for data vectors of lengths N = 2K. They proceed by dividing the DFT into two DFTs of length N=2 each, and iterating. There are …

WebFFT‐IFFT modules are made to support 2k/4k/8k FFT and IFFT algorithms. FFT‐IFFT 2k/4k/8k Core are built using the radix 2, radix 4 and radix 8. Core is designed to be able …

WebAug 16, 2024 · This is a 1024 power-of-two standard FFT fp = fft (p); fq = fft (q); fr = fft (r); fs = fft (s); fp4 = [fp fp fp fp]; fq4 = [fq fq fq fq]; fr4 = [fr fr fr fr]; fs4 = [fs fs fs fs]; fp4 = reshape (fp4,n,1); fq4 = reshape (fq4,n,1); fr4 = reshape (fr4,n,1); fs4 = reshape (fs4,n,1); % calculate the 4096 twiddle factors k4 = (0:n-1)'; W4 = exp … office manager pay scale 2022 ukWebIts derived based on the recursive structure of FFT. Where the splitting algorithm of N-point DFT into 2 N/2 point DFTs is applied for three consequtive stages. Mathematical definition of the solution is as follows: Assume that N -point DFT X [ k] is split into two N / 2 point DFTS according to the even and odd partitioning as usual: office manager on resumeWebAug 1, 2015 · This study deals with the design and implementation of a 256-point Radix-4 100 Gbit/s FFT, where computational steps are reconsidered and optimized for high-speed applications, such as radar and fiber optics. mycore fvb powered by eventcore gmbhWebApr 1, 2024 · The sequence of exponents exp(j*2*pi/N*(0 : N-1)) is called twiddle factors as for FFT . Like FFT , The IFFT computes the time response in ~N*log 2 N operations for radix 2 algorithm and ~N*log 4 N operations for radix 4 algorithm instead of N 2 operations that are required when calculating explicitly the IDFT . myco rebecca grey sofa with pull out ottomanWebAug 27, 2013 · Matlab code for radix-4 fft algorithm. August 27, 2013 in Uncategorized %% FFT algorithm for radix-4 clc; clear all; close all; N=64; data=randi([0 4],1,N); for l=1:4 for m=1:N/4 x(l,m)=data(4*(m-1)+l); end end F=zeros(4,N/4); for l=1:4 for q=1:N/4 for m=1:N/4 F(l,q)=F(l,q)+x(l,m)*exp(-2*pi*1i*(m-1)*(q-1)*4/N); end end end mycore constructions mackayWebMay 7, 2011 · universal mixed radix fast fourier transform FFT iFFT c++ source code radix-2 radix-3 radix-4 radix-5 radix-7 radix-11 c++ , + inverse table, with shift fi . Quicker version … office manager opis stanowiskaWebAs a conclusion, 64 points FFT computation based on radix-4 method needs totally 4 stages including re-order. The computation architecture is shown in figure 8. Figure 8 RADIX-4 64 points FFT architecture Radix-4 64 points FFT by MATLAB Here we provide radix-4 64 points FFT by MATLAB code: myfft64.m office manager pay rate nz